Understanding 判决

The word 判决 specifically refers to a legal judgment or decision made by a court. It is a formal term used in legal contexts to describe the conclusion of a trial or legal proceeding.

Usage in Conversation

When using 判决, speakers often refer to the official decision issued by a judge or court. It can be used to discuss the outcome of a case, express opinions about the fairness of the decision, or describe the legal process.

Nuances and Tips

判决 is a formal legal term and is not used for everyday judgments or decisions. For general decisions, words like 决定 or 选择 are more appropriate. Avoid confusing 判决 with , which can mean to judge or determine but is less formal and used in broader contexts.

When discussing legal matters, using 判决 correctly shows a good understanding of judicial language and helps in precise communication.

Example Sentences

法院今天对这起案件作出了判决。

Fǎyuàn jīntiān duì zhè qǐ ànjiàn zuòchūle pànjué.

The court made a judgment on this case today.

他对判决结果表示不满,准备上诉。

Tā duì pànjué jiéguǒ biǎoshì bùmǎn, zhǔnbèi shàngsù.

He expressed dissatisfaction with the judgment and is preparing to appeal.

判决书详细说明了法官的理由和依据。

Pànjué shū xiángxì shuōmíngle fǎguān de lǐyóu hé yījù.

The judgment document explains in detail the judge's reasons and basis.
